1. Faster Turnaround Time Reduces Labor Costs
Traditional machining often requires manual intervention, setup, and supervision. In contrast, CNC (Computer Numerical Control) machines run autonomously once programmed, drastically reducing the time and labor needed to complete a part.
💡 Key Benefits:
-
Minimal manual handling
-
Simultaneous multi-axis operations
-
24/7 production with automation
Less labor time translates to lower overall manufacturing costs, especially for medium to large production volumes.

2. Higher Precision Means Less Waste
CNC machining delivers exceptional accuracy and repeatability. Unlike manual methods, CNC machines follow exact digital designs, minimizing material waste caused by human error or inaccurate cutting.
🎯 Result:
-
Fewer defective parts
-
Lower scrap rates
-
Reduced rework and quality control costs
Precision = profitability.

3. Scalability Without Sacrificing Quality
Whether you’re producing a single prototype or thousands of parts, CNC machining scales seamlessly. Traditional methods often require more setup and adjustment for each new batch, increasing time and cost.
With CNC:
-
Set it once, repeat with consistency
-
Programs are easily stored and reused
-
Ideal for batch production and on-demand manufacturing
This makes CNC machining a cost-effective solution for both low- and high-volume projects.

4. Less Tooling and Setup Costs Over Time
While initial CNC machine programming can take time, the long-term savings are significant. Traditional machining often requires custom jigs, fixtures, or manual adjustments for each part, increasing overhead.
With CNC:
-
One-time digital programming
-
Reusable designs
-
No need for extensive tooling or setup changes
The more parts you produce, the cheaper each unit becomes.

5. Reduced Downtime and Maintenance
Modern CNC machines are built for reliability and continuous operation. With proper maintenance, they experience less downtime than manual machines, which often depend on the operator’s skill and vigilance.
🛠 CNC Advantages:
-
Predictive maintenance alerts
-
Fewer moving manual components
-
Automated error detection
Fewer interruptions mean higher productivity and lower maintenance costs.

6. Integration With CAD/CAM Software Saves Engineering Time
CNC machining integrates directly with CAD (Computer-Aided Design) and CAM (Computer-Aided Manufacturing) software, shortening the time between concept and production.
You don’t need to create multiple physical prototypes or drawings—just upload your design file, and production can begin.
🎨 Benefits:
-
Faster prototyping
-
Real-time simulation of part geometry
-
Design optimization for machining
Less time in the design-to-manufacture cycle = more savings.
